Specializations in Nursing Jobs

Registered nurses form the backbone of healthcare, providing patient care, educating patients and the public about various health conditions, and offering emotional support to patients and their families. They work in hospitals, physicians’ offices, home healthcare services, and nursing care facilities.

Nurse Practitioners

Nurse practitioners are advanced practice registered nurses who can diagnose and treat illnesses. They work in various specialties, such as family, adult-gerontology, pediatric, and psychiatric-mental health. NPs often collaborate with physicians and can prescribe medications in many states.

Nurse Anesthetists 

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etists are specialized nurses who administer anesthesia and oversee the patient’s recovery during surgeries. They play a vital role in the operating room, ensuring patients are comfortable and safe during procedures.

Educational Requirements and Career Growth

To embark on a nursing career, aspiring individuals can pursue various educational pathways, including diploma programs, associate degrees in nursing (ADN), or bachelor’s degrees in nursing (BSN). Additionally, higher education, such as master’s and doctoral degrees, opens doors to specialized roles and leadership positions.

Career Growth and Advancement

Nursing jobs offer substantial room for career growth. Experienced nurses can advance into roles like nurse managers, clinical nurse specialists, or nurse educators. Additionally, obtaining certifications in specialized areas enhances professional credibility and opens avenues for higher-paying positions.
